Practical Tips for Crafters
Before you start selling your finished products, here are some practical tips to ensure the best results:
- Test the File: Always test the SVG file on a small scale before moving to larger projects. This helps you identify any issues with the design early on.
- Check SVG Lines: Ensure the SVG lines are clean and crisp. This is crucial for a professional finish, especially in Cricut and Silhouette projects.
- Preview PNG Transparency: If you’re using the PNG version, check the transparency to make sure it blends seamlessly with your background.
- Confirm Resolution for Sublimation: For sublimation designs, confirm that the resolution is high enough to produce clear, vibrant prints.
- Test Colors: Print a sample to see how the colors look on both white and dark backgrounds. This will help you choose the right color combinations for your products.
- Use Real Mockups: Place the design on real mockups to visualize how it will look on different products. This step is essential for creating appealing product listings.
- Resize for Different Products: Resize the design to fit various product dimensions, ensuring it looks balanced and visually appealing on each item.
- Simplify the Layout if Needed: If the design feels too busy, consider simplifying it. This can make it more suitable for smaller items like stickers or gift tags.
- Font Pairings: Experiment with different font styles, such as serif, sans serif, script, or handwritten fonts, to complement the design and enhance its overall appeal.
- Commercial Licensing: Confirm that the design includes a commercial license, allowing you to use it for customer orders and handmade business products without any legal issues.
